Utility-Scale Battery Storage Rqmts.
SB 728 requires permits for utility-scale battery storage systems (1+ megawatt capacity) in North Carolina, affecting companies building or operating these facilities. The bill mandates that owners submit emergency response plans, decommissioning plans, and proof of financial responsibility to the Department of Environmental Quality before installation. It requires systems to be properly decommissioned within one year of shutdown, including recycling components like batteries and cables, restoring the site to pre-installation conditions, and covering all associated costs. Owners must also coordinate with local emergency officials and detail disposal methods for hazardous waste under the plan.
